image/svg+xml
FREE PALESTINE

تحليل كائنات JSON في بايثون _ امثلة بايثون

ملخص

سنشرح في هذا المنشور كيف يمكنك تحليل كائنات JSON في Python.

تعد معرفة كيفية تحليل كائنات JSON مفيدة عندما تريد الوصول إلى واجهة برمجة تطبيقات من خدمات الويب المختلفة التي تقدم الاستجابة بتنسيق JSON.

ابدء

أول شيء عليك القيام به هو العثور على عنوان URL لاستدعاء API.

في المثال الخاص بي ، سأستخدم Twitter API.

ابدأ باستيراد الوحدات التي نحتاجها للبرنامج.

import json
import urllib2
Code language: JavaScript (javascript)

افتح عنوان URL واسم الشاشة.

url = "http://api.twitter.com/1/statuses/user_timeline.json?screen_name=wordpress"
Code language: JavaScript (javascript)

اطبع النتيجة

print data
Code language: PHP (php)
استخدام Twitter API لتحليل البيانات

هذا برنامج بسيط للغاية ، فقط لإعطائك فكرة عن كيفية عمله.

#Importing modules
import json
import urllib2

# Open the URL and the screen name
url = "http://api.twitter.com/1/statuses/user_timeline.json?screen_name=wordpress"

# This takes a python object and dumps it to a string which is a JSON representation of that object
data = json.load(urllib2.urlopen(url))

#print the result
print data
Code language: PHP (php)

إذا كنت مهتمًا برؤية مثال آخر عن كيفية استخدام JSON في Python ، من فضلك إلقاء نظرة على البرنامج النصي “IMDB Crawler”.

لاستخدام Twitter API ، راجع الوثائق الرسمية على Twitter. https://dev.twitter.com/docs

لا يوجد اعجابات